Mahjong movie - Mahjong movie is a subgenre of Chinese gambling films that focuses on Mahjong games and over-the-top tile-playing skills. The movie can be either a comedy or an action movie (occasionally with distinctive elements of Chinese kung fu). Top Gun (roller coaster) - Top Gun is a steel roller coaster by Vekoma featured at Paramount Canada's Wonderland. It's theme is based on the film, Top Gun, and has various movie-themed things along the long line-up for the ride, such as small airplane hangars for shade. Top Gun (soundtrack) - Top Gun is the soundtrack from the movie of the same name starring Tom Cruise, released in 1986 by Sony Music. In 1999, it was reissued in a Special Expanded Edition with extra tracks added.
